Inside the ESL System: Labels, Network, and Software

An ESL system has three interdependent layers. Understanding each one helps you evaluate whether a solution is genuinely enterprise-ready.
Price tag icon

The Labels

Digital shelf-edge displays in multiple sizes and formats. Each label uses e-paper or similar low-power display technology, giving it years of battery life without replacement. Labels are mounted on standard shelf rails, peg hooks, freezer doors, or specialty fixtures.

Gear icon

The Communication Network

Infrastructure installed throughout the store that transmits pricing updates to individual labels. MarginMate’s system uses Zero Wireless Bandwidth technology – bi-directional diffused infrared – meaning updates never compete with your store Wi-Fi, POS terminals, or customer devices.

Trophy icon

The Management Software

The platform that connects your POS, ERP, or pricing system to every label in every store. It handles integrations, manages label templates, schedules promotions, and provides a centralized view of pricing status across all locations. All updates are centrally managed and available for both cloud and on-premises configurations.

Electronic Shelf Labeling for Prices, Promos, and Compliance

ESLs do more than display a price. A well-configured electronic shelf labeling system turns every shelf edge into a live communication channel between your pricing system and your shoppers.

What you can display and manage:

  • Regular and promotional pricing – switch instantly between the everyday price and promo price without touching the shelf
  • Unit pricing and compliance fields – display per-unit price, weight, or volume to meet shelf-labeling regulations
  • Barcodes and product identifiers – scannable barcodes on the label itself for faster stock management
  • Staff-facing back pages – additional label pages accessible via handheld IR key for stock quantity, replenishment flags, and internal product info
  • SmartFLASH LED – flash individual labels in under one second to guide staff to the right shelf location for click-and-collect, put-to-light replenishment, or shopper pick lists
  • Planogram-aware display – configure templates by department or category so labels match your merchandising format automatically

ESL System vs. Paper Labels at a Glance

For retailers still evaluating whether the switch makes sense, here is what changes operationally:

Capability ESL System Paper Labels
Price update speed Seconds, store-wide Hours, tag by tag
Shelf-to-POS accuracy Always synchronized Prone to human error
Promotion execution Instant across all locations Manual, slow to execute
Labor requirement Minimal after deployment Recurring, weekly effort
Multi-store control Centralized platform Store-by-store process
Compliance display Dynamic, always current Reprint required for each change

Frequently Asked Questions

What is an ESL system?

An ESL system is the combination of three components: the electronic shelf labels themselves, a store communication network that transmits updates to those labels, and management software that connects to your POS or pricing system. Together, they allow price and product information to update automatically across every shelf in the store.

Updates are triggered in your existing POS, ERP, or pricing system – no change to your current workflow. The ESL platform receives those updates through an integration or scheduled pricing file, identifies the affected labels, and transmits new pricing through the store infrastructure. Each label refreshes its display automatically, typically within seconds.
